The very first Middlebury New Filmmakers Festival (MNFF), kicking off August 27-30, celebrates the work of emerging voices in filmmaking. The emphasis at the MNFF is entirely on filmmakers who have created within the past two years either their first or second feature film or first or second short film. All genres are welcome including narrative, documentary, animation and experimental. The firm commitment at the MNFF is to offer a level playing field to new filmmakers, to give audiences throughout the region an opportunity to discover fresh and engaging talent and to give filmmakers a chance to be discovered in a setting that is all about their work. The MNFF closed its window for submissions this past and was thrilled to receive over 320 films from 35 countries, far exceeding initial expectations. The Festival's lineup of films will be announced in early August. The MNFF is screening 95 films at four screening venues throughout town: the Upper and Lower Screening Rooms at Middlebury Marquis, Middlebury College's Dana Auditorium, and the Town Hall Theater which will also function as the Festival's main Box Office. More than 25 filmmakers will attend and answer questions about their work following screenings, and will also be available to meet filmgoers at a variety of pop-up locations around Middlebury. The Festival will offer a variety of parties throughout the weekend, including the open-to-everyone Saturday Night Community Party from 7-10:30pm with live music on the Town Green, as well as several food trucks and beverage tents.
